Shakari "Kari" Lewis, LPCÂ is a Licensed Professional Counselor with over a decade of experience in mental health therapy. Now entering her fourth year in collegiate athletics, she serves as the Director of Student-Athlete Mental Health and Sports Performance at Marquette University, where she leads the mental health strategy for over 350 elite student-athletes.Â
Kari provides comprehensive, culturally competent care focused on emotional resilience, performance optimization, and holistic wellness. She has developed and implemented foundational policies around confidentiality, informed consent, and integrated mental health operations, ensuring that student-athletes receive high-quality, ethical support in a safe and trusted environment.
With a deep commitment to athlete empowerment, Kari delivers tailored workshops, and team consultations to help student-athletes strengthen their mental health and enhance their performance on and off the field. Her work is grounded in the belief that mental well-being is essential to achieving both peak performance and long-term personal success.
Kari actively collaborates with colleagues across the Big East Conference and remains engaged in the Counseling and Clinical Sport Psychology community, continually advancing her practice, peer consultation, and professional development.
Outside of work, she enjoys traveling with her family and is on a mission to visit all 50 states before her children turn 18.
